How they compare
Kiribati currently reports 98.4% against 98.0% in Nepal, a difference of 0.4%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 6 shared years of data; in 2014 it was Kiribati ahead.
Kiribati ranks 59th and Nepal ranks 61st of 113 countries.
Kiribati has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Kiribati | Nepal |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010s | 95.8% | 94.2% | 1.6% | Kiribati |
| 2020s | 98.6% | 95.4% | 3.2% | Kiribati |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
